Common Wasps & Hornets in Phoenix
You’ll typically encounter:
- Paper Wasps (Polistes spp.) – The most common, with open, umbrella-shaped nests under roofs, patio covers, and playground equipment. Slender, reddish-brown or yellow/black.
- Mud Daubers – Solitary wasps that build little mud tubes in garages, sheds, or eaves. Usually non-aggressive, but messy!
- Yellowjackets (Vespula spp.) – Compact, aggressive, ground- or wall-nesting wasps. Black and yellow, often mistaken for bees but far more defensive.
- Bald-faced Hornets (Dolichovespula maculata) – Actually a type of yellowjacket; build large, football-shaped aerial nests in trees or on buildings.
Why Are Wasps Dangerous?
- Stings can be severe: Unlike bees, wasps and hornets can sting multiple times.
- Allergies: Their venom can trigger severe allergic reactions in sensitive individuals—don’t take chances.
- Aggressive defense: Wasps become highly territorial if you approach their nest, especially yellowjackets and hornets.
- Hidden nests: Wasps build in unexpected places—inside walls, BBQ grills, playgrounds, irrigation boxes, even underground.
- Multiple nests:
- Unlike bees (who build a single, “cathedral” hive), many wasp species build several small nests across their territory, maximizing survival and dominance.
- This makes them harder to fully remove without professional help.

Why We Don’t Relocate Wasps (and Why That’s Okay!)
While honey bees are precious pollinators that deserve a second chance, wasps are… well, a bit more complicated. Live removal of wasp nests simply isn’t practical or prudent. Unlike honey bees, wasps aren’t endangered, and their colonies are fiercely defensive, making relocation risky and rarely successful.
But don’t worry—they’re not villains! In the wild, wasps play a vital role as natural pest controllers, keeping other insect populations in check.
